Christina's Child Care Platform.

97-page operational platform for a family-run childcare business

AI-NativeClient BuildChildcare

Shipped a 97-page operational platform on Next.js 14 and Supabase that runs iPad kiosk attendance, family management, employee registration, CACFP financial tracking, and a Claude Haiku 4.5 recommendation layer where scan results produce action cards with approve-deny feedback that feeds the next recommendation.

The hardest call was the dual-write localStorage fallback: Supabase is the source of truth for everything, but connectivity in the actual center is inconsistent, so every client action writes to both stores and the kiosk functions offline with queued reconciliation on reconnect. That resolved a week-one operational blocker that pure cloud would have missed.

I would build the fitness-test harness first. I shipped features, then discovered three weeks later that a 35-test operational fitness suite against a realistic seeded day was the real deliverable because it reframed every future feature decision around actual center operations rather than feature wishlists.

Outcomes

  • Replaced $45,600/year SaaS with a $600/year custom platform
  • Operational fitness test graded platform B on first real-day simulation
  • Intelligence layer surfaces CACFP under-claiming (7.4% vs. 8-12% industry baseline)
